1920-1985 COLOSSAL COLLECTION IN FOUR VOLUMES An extensive mint and used collection assembled by a dedicated collector with stamps arranged as per the Peter Meyer specialised catalogue of Brazil stamps, and which features many identified errors, misprints, watermark varieties, perforation and paper varieties, etc. The first volume alone for example contains hundreds of stamps from the 1920-40 definitive issues with all of the various watermarks and printings well represented, 1929-40 good range of Air issues with various watermarks etc, plus 1931 Revolution complete sets of 14 both fine mint and used plus a range of mint and used multiples, 1931 "ZEPPELIN" overprint sets of five both mint and used, 1932 Colonization sets both mint and used, 1932 Sao Paulo sets both mint and used, 1933 Justo sets both mint and used, 1934 Stamp Exhib set mint (plus in mint blocks of four), 1934 Cristos both tete-beche pairs mint, 1935 Terra sets both mint and used, 1935 Child Welfare set mint, 1937-38 Tourism set to 5,000r mint plus most values to 10,000r used, 1938 Rowland Hill mini-sheets x2 used, 1938 Constitution mini-sheets mint, 1940 New York Fair (second issue) set mint and used plus 1m and 5m mini-sheets NHM without gum (as issued). The second volume includes further definitive issues, 1943 Stamp Anniv (both sets) both mint and used, the Postage mini-sheets both mint and used, plus the Air mini-sheet mint, 1944 Air surch set mint, 1945 Expeditionary Force set mint, 1946 Postal Congress set NHM, 1948 Pres Dutra Air mini-sheet NHM without gum (as issued) and so on, then the third and fourth volumes with similar big ranges of issues for the period with many of the mint stamps being never hinged.
